Conclusion Meanings:

'Exonerated': or 'Within NYPD Guidelines' - The conduct occurred but did not violate the NYPD's own rules, which often give officers significant discretion.
'Unfounded': Evidence suggests that the event or alleged conduct did not occur.
'Unsubstantiated': or 'Unable to Determine' - The alleged conduct was investigated but could not determine both that the conduct occurred and that it broke the rules.

Smith, Elijah M. vs City of New York, et al.
Case # 024611/2017E, Supreme Court - Bronx, June 28, 2017, ended June 7, 2018
$250,000 Settlement
Complaint, Summons/Complaint
Description: On or about May 27, 2016, defendant NYPD officers Sasha Brugal, Corey Wooten, Chris Aybar, Merita Hotha, along with unnamed defendant NYPD officers unlawfully arrested, detained and confined plaintiff, and proceeded to provide false information to prosecutors to maliciously prosecute plaintiff, on the basis of racism and prejudice. Plaintiff received great and severe physical and mental injuries as a result of this incident. Charges against plaintiff were later dropped.
